THE VENUE

Nestled between the majestic peaks of the Swiss Alps, the Grand Hotel Belvedere in Wengen is a haven of tranquility, regeneration, and conscious retreat. This 5-star hotel seamlessly blends alpine tradition with modern elegance, offering an inspiring backdrop for yoga and wellbeing retreats year-round.

Stylish rooms and suites provide a private sanctuary, while the Susanne Kaufmann Spa, inspired by Japanese culture, along with heated indoor and outdoor pools, and a private forest, create spaces for deep relaxation, mindfulness, and renewed energy.

A special highlight for our retreats is the new Yurt at the forest’s edge – a unique power spot for yoga, meditation, and breathwork. Surrounded by nature, it encourages you to quiet your mind, deepen your breath, and bring harmony to body and spirit.

The venue offers different type of rooms, two restaurants (one with a terrace), two bars, a spa and pool complex, a fitness room, and a private forest – the perfect setting for a holistic mountain retreat experience.
